Series R45 Rotopulser® Incremental Encoders
Quick Specs...
- Direct mount to NEMA 56C through 184C AC or DC motors
- Field replaceable readhead for easy service
- Complete electrical protection and proven noise immunity
- Optional line driver outputs, screw terminal connections
- Thin profile – only 5/8" thick
Overview / Design Principle:
The separately mounted ring and gear are designed to function without any
setup or adjustments. Operation is reliable even in wet, dirty, and extreme
industrial temperature environments. No flexible shaft coupling is required,
and there are no bearings to wear out, meaning greater mechanical reliability.
Coupled with a frequency-to-voltage converter, such as the Dynapar brand FV3,
the R45 Rotopulser® provides a precise, brushless feedback, at a lower
cost than expensive DC tachometer-generators.
An optional, X2 speed output provides twice the number of pulses per revolution
for improved low speed operation. Line driver outputs are available for installations
with long cable runs. A screw terminal option further simplifies field wiring.
The Series R45 Rotopulser® comes with all necessary mounting hardware included.
Features and Benefits:
- Unique hub design uses a split collar clamp that provides better gear
retention than set screws and will not raise burrs on the motor shaft which
can make
removal difficult.
- Thinnest package available, allowing more through shaft extension for
clutches and brakes.
- "Overhung" conduit box allows mounting to the rear accessory
flange of larger motors without mechanical interference.

Applications:
The Dynapar brand Series R45 Rotopulser® mounts directly to motors with
a front or rear 4-1/2 NEMA C-face to provide digital feedback for RPM readout,
speed control, and positioning
Specifications:
Standard Operating Characteristics
Code: Incremental
Resolution: 60 PPR (pulses/revolution)
Format: Single channel unidirectional (A), or two channel quadrature (AB)
outputs
Quadrature Phasing: 90° ±45° electrical
Symmetry: 180° ±36° electrical
Electrical
Input Power: (not including output loads)
Single ended 4.5 min. to 16.5 VDC max. at 50 mA max.;
Open collector and differential line driver: 4.5 min. to 26 VDC max. at 75
mA max.
Outputs: Single ended with 2 kO pullup: 16.5 VDC max., 20 mA sink at 0.5
V max.;
Open Collector: 30 VDC max., 40 mA sink max.;
7272 Differential Line Driver: 40 mA sink or source
Frequency Response: 10 kHz min.
Electrical Protection: Overvoltage and reverse voltage to 30 VDC; output
short circuit protected to Common or other outputs, to +V (differential line
driver
only)
Noise Immunity: Tested to EN50082-2 (Heavy Industrial) for Electro Static
Discharge, Radio Frequency Interference, Electrical Fast Transients, Conducted
and Magnetic
Interference
Terminations: Wire leads: 7" long min., 18 AWG;
Screw terminals: accept 22 to 14 AWG solid or stranded wires
Mechanical
Motor frame sizes: 56C, 143TC, 145TC, 182C and 184C
Motor shaft/hub sizes: 5/8", 7/8" nominal
Housing: Cast Aluminum, chromate finish
Gear: 1010 Steel
Moment of Inertia: 0.0035 -in-lb-sec2
Shaft Speed: 5,000 RPM max.
Readhead to gear gap: 0.020" nominal, 0.030 max.
Allowable Endplay: ±0.060
Environmental
Operating Temperature: -40 to +85°C
Storage Temperature: -40 to +90°C
Shock: 20 G's for 11 milliseconds duration
Vibration: 5 to 2000 Hz at 2.5 G's
Humidity: to 98% without condensation
